
Microsoft has announced the first wave of games coming to Xbox Game Pass this month. This includes over a dozen titles with something for every player – from fast-paced racing and intense action to more relaxed, story-driven experiences. It’s a clear effort to keep the service exciting and provide plenty of new content for Xbox Game Pass subscribers.
Recently, Xbox has made some big changes to its subscription services. With Asha Sharma now leading the Xbox team, the price of Game Pass Ultimate has been lowered to $22.99 a month. This is part of an effort to attract more subscribers as the company moves forward after Phil Spencer’s leadership. Also, Microsoft announced that new Call of Duty games will now be added to the service a year after they launch, instead of being available on day one.
List of Xbox Game Pass Games Coming Soon
Xbox Game Pass Wave 1 Lineup for May 2026
- May 6 — Ben 10: Power Trip (Cloud, Console, PC) Game Pass Ultimate, Game Pass Premium, PC Game Pass
- May 6 — Descenders Next (Cloud, Console, PC) Game Pass Premium
- May 6 — Wheel World (Cloud, Xbox Series X/S, PC) Game Pass Premium
- May 6 — Wildgate (Cloud, Xbox Series X/S, PC) Game Pass Ultimate, Game Pass Premium, PC Game Pass
- May 6 — Wuchang: Fallen Feathers (Cloud, Xbox Series X/S, PC) Game Pass Premium
- May 7 — Mixtape (Cloud, Xbox Series X/S, Handheld, PC) Game Pass Ultimate, PC Game Pass
- May 11 — Outbound (Cloud, Console, PC) Game Pass Ultimate, PC Game Pass
- May 12 — Black Jacket (Cloud, Xbox Series X/S, Handheld, PC) Game Pass Ultimate, PC Game Pass
- May 12 — Call of the Elder Gods (Cloud, Xbox Series X/S, Handheld, PC) Game Pass Ultimate, PC Game Pass
- May 12 — Elite: Dangerous (Cloud, Console) Game Pass Ultimate, Game Pass Premium
- May 14 — DOOM: The Dark Ages (Cloud, Xbox Series X/S, Handheld, PC) Game Pass Premium
- May 14 — Subnautica 2 (Cloud, Xbox Series X/S, Handheld, PC) Game Pass Ultimate, PC Game Pass
- May 19 — Forza Horizon 6 (Cloud, Xbox Series X/S, Handheld, PC) Game Pass Ultimate, PC Game Pass
The biggest highlight of May’s Xbox Game Pass lineup is Forza Horizon 6, launching directly into the service on May 19. This new installment takes the high-octane racing festival to Japan, featuring a huge open world and over 550 cars to collect and drive. Also arriving on May 14 is DOOM: The Dark Ages, which is moving from the standard Game Pass to the Premium tier. This game delves into the origins of the Slayer’s rage in a medieval setting. Players can also get an early look at Subnautica 2 on May 14 with a preview of the game, offering underwater survival on a brand-new alien planet with support for up to four players. With such diverse locations—from the bright streets of Japan to dark, gothic battlefields—these additions offer something for everyone, though they will take up a significant amount of storage space.

The service isn’t just about big-name games; it’s also focusing on more unique and relaxing experiences. On May 7th, Mixtape will be released, a nostalgic story about growing up with friends, told through music and inspired by classic teen movies. Then, on May 11th, Outbound lets you escape to a simpler life by customizing and living in a van. For fans of mystery and the supernatural, Call of the Elder Gods arrives on May 12th, continuing the adventure from Call of the Sea with challenging puzzles. Also on May 12th, Black Jacket offers a stylish and intense take on blackjack, set in a strange afterlife where bending the rules is expected.
The month starts off strong with a lot of new additions! On May 5th, the classic RPG Final Fantasy 5 unexpectedly arrives. Then, on May 6th, even more games are added, including both brand-new titles and some moving to the Premium tier. Subscribers can look forward to action-packed Ben 10 Power Trip and tactical shooter Wildgate being added for everyone. Meanwhile, Wuchang: Fallen Feathers, Descenders Next, and Wheel World will be available only to Premium members, expanding the library for those players. If you enjoy earning achievements, Ben 10 and Wheel World are good choices as they’re relatively quick to complete. Finally, on May 12th, Elite Dangerous returns, offering a vast and immersive space simulation experience.
Free Game Giveaways
As new games are added to the service, some titles will be leaving Game Pass on May 15th. These include the visually stunning platformer Planet of Lana and the unique hospital simulator Galacticare. Also departing are Go Mecha Ball, Kulebra and the Souls of Limbo, and the kid-friendly Paw Patrol Rescue Wheels. Players who want to keep these games can purchase them with a 20% discount before they’re removed. With such a robust lineup of additions and removals, Microsoft is demonstrating high expectations for Game Pass throughout the year, despite recent changes in leadership and subscription options.
